You just received a message from the internet which was encrypted with asymmetric encryption. what do you need to do to read the
Bezzdna [24]
Assuming the data was encrypted with YOUR public key, you'll need YOUR private key to decrypt it. That's answer e.

a and b are not solutions by themselves, of course you need to use the decryption algorithm, but a key goes with it.

c would be about symmetric encryption, but this is asymmetric, so different keys are used for encryption and decryption

d is possible, but it would mean anyone can decrypt it (after all the key is public), so then there's no point in encrypting it in the first place.

So e is the only logical answer.

Name the character encoding standard that enables up to 128 different commonly used characters,
Lelechka [254]

Answer:

ASCII character set.

Explanation:

ASCII is an acronym for American Standard Code for Information Interchange and it was developed from a telegraph code. It is typically a character encoding standard that comprises of seven-bit (7-bit) set of codes.

ASCII character set is the character encoding standard that enables up to 128 different commonly used characters, numbers and symbols to be used in electronic communication systems. The ASCII character set is only used for encoding English language and it comprises of both the lower case and upper case letters of the 26 alphabets, number 0 to 9 and symbols.
